The incenter of a triangle is the point from which the distances to the sides are equal, in this point we can start to construct the inscribed circle in the triangle, because the incenter would also be the center of the circumference.

In this stanza of Pound's poem, the writer uses free verse. The first option, blank verse, refers to a way of writing which uses iambic pentameters; there are also 10 syllables per verse. Iambic meter, option C, is a metrical foot composed by 2 syllables (one weak, one stressed); blank verse is one example of these, as mentioned before. Finally, a sonnet, option D, is a more rigid structure, where the poem has only 14 lines and all of them have to rhyme, but the kind of sonnet would define this and other rules.

Lorraine Hansberry's A Raisin in the Sun tells the story of the Younger family in the South side of Chicago. Being African American, their life amidst the racial discrimination and the conflict of interest among the different generations of the family themselves constitute the plot of the play.

Act III shows the family scene after Walter, the Younger son has lost the insurance money given to him to start his own business. And Mr. Lindner was the agent for the community at Clybourne Park who had sent him to give the message that the Youngers are not welcomed there. So, Walter called him in the hope that they (the Younger family) will take the money offered to them in exchange for cancelling their move into the white neighborhood.

The title 'Animal Farm' of George Orwell's classic novel is significant as it establishes the setting for the allegorical story. The tale depicts a revolution of barnyard animals against their human owner, symbolizing a broader social and political commentary. Over the course of the narrative, aspirations of freedom and justice lead to a new oppressive regime, echoing Orwell's critique of totalitarianism. The phrase, "All animals are equal, but some animals are more equal than others," encapsulates the eventual hypocrisy and inequality that arises, reflecting the author's warning about how power can corrupt ideals. The significance of the title also conveys the dichotomy of perception, where what seems to be a simple farm setting is actually a complex representation of sociopolitical systems.

Part I: The poem begins with a description of a river and a road that pass through long fields of barley and rye before reaching the town of Camelot. The people of the town travel along the road and look toward an island called Shalott, which lies further down the river. The island of Shalott contains several plants and flowers, including lilies, aspens, and willows. On the island, a woman known as the Lady of Shalott is imprisoned within a building made of “four gray walls and four gray towers.”

Both “heavy barges” and light open boats sail along the edge of the river to Camelot. But has anyone seen or heard of the lady who lives on the island in the river? Only the reapers who harvest the barley hear the echo of her singing. At night, the tired reaper listens to her singing and whispers that he hears her: “ ‘Tis the fairy Lady of Shalott.”

Symbolism, as it pertains to literature, is best described by option C: A writer uses an object to represent significant ideas or qualities. This literary device involves the use of symbols to signify ideas and qualities by way of giving them symbolic meanings different from their literal meanings. That is, a symbol, in a literary sense, holds more than just its visible or surface meaning. For example, a dove is a bird but in literature it popularly symbolizes peace.

It's important not to confuse symbolism with simile (which uses the words 'like' or 'as' to compare things), or with allegory (which is a narrative where characters and actions hold symbolic meanings). Both of these are different literary devices.

Also, while symbolism can be used to emphasize important themes in a text (option D), the statement does not entirely encapsulate what symbolism is in the context of literature.
